Onnit Alpha Brain Nootropic Access and Procurement

The pursuit of cognitive enhancement through nootropics has led to the emergence of Onnit Labs’ Alpha Brain, a flagship product from the Texas-based health and wellness company established in 2011. Inspired by the interests of celebrity Joe Rogan regarding the potential of nootropics to enhance cognitive function, Alpha Brain is engineered as a daily, caffeine-free supplement intended to provide comprehensive cognitive support. The primary objectives of the formulation are to improve memory, enhance focus, and increase mental processing speed. Because the product targets these specific neurological functions, it is designed for adult users, with the strong recommendation that individuals consult a healthcare provider prior to initiation.

The strategic design of Alpha Brain positions it as an alternative for those who seek cognitive support without the jittery effects or stimulant-heavy profiles associated with coffee or other caffeine-based enhancers. This distinction is critical for users who are particularly sensitive to stimulants. The product's delivery system utilizes a capsule format, packaged in translucent plastic bottles that allow the consumer to visually verify the contents. The packaging is further enhanced by a rubbery coating on the lid, which facilitates an easier grip for opening and closing the container.

To ensure user success, Onnit provides clear instructions for consumption. While the standard full serving size is two capsules daily, preferably taken with a light meal, the company suggests a gradual titration process. New users are encouraged to start with a single capsule and build up to the full dose. A strict safety limitation is imposed, advising consumers not to exceed one serving within any 24-hour period. This structured approach to dosage is intended to help users acclimate to the supplement while maintaining safety parameters.

Product Specifications and Formulation Architecture

Alpha Brain is constructed around a complex architectural framework consisting of three proprietary blends. These blends are specifically designed to target different mechanisms within the brain to facilitate peak function. In addition to these blends, the formulation includes precise measurements of specific additives, namely 10mg of vitamin B6 and 350mg of cat’s claw (Uncaria tomentosa) extract.

The use of proprietary blends allows Onnit to describe the intended goal of each ingredient on its product page, explaining what each component is thought to do and how it contributes to the overall cognitive goal. However, this approach creates a lack of transparency regarding the exact dosages of individual ingredients. This obfuscation makes it difficult for consumers to estimate the potential for side effects stemming from riskier nootropic ingredients.

Procurement Options and Financial Incentives

Acquiring Alpha Brain involves several pathways, primarily through the official Onnit website or the brand's Amazon store. For the most cost-effective procurement, the Onnit website is the recommended channel due to the availability of substantial discounts and specific guarantees.

The most significant financial incentive is the subscription program, which provides a 25% discount on recurring orders. Subscriptions are highly flexible, allowing users to schedule refills as frequently as once per week. To prevent financial risk, cards are not charged until the package ships, and subscriptions can be canceled at any time without penalty.

For first-time buyers, Onnit offers a "Keep-It" money-back guarantee. This 90-day guarantee is applied exclusively to the first purchase of the 30-count bottle (it does not apply to the 90-count version). If a user is unsatisfied with the product, they receive a full refund and are permitted to keep the product. Additionally, new users can secure 10% off their first order by signing up for the company newsletter.

Onnit also maintains a "Community Discount" for specific professional groups. This 15% discount is available for one-time purchases to the following individuals:

  • Military personnel
  • First responders
  • Medical providers
  • Teachers

It is important to note that the Community Discount does not apply to subscription orders or items already on sale. While bulk purchasing discounts were previously offered (up to 30% off for three bottles), this option has been discontinued.

Cost Analysis and Servings

Alpha Brain is sold in two primary bottle sizes: 30-count and 90-count. Because the standard daily dosage is two capsules, the actual supply duration is shorter than the capsule count suggests.

Product Size Standard Price Subscription Price Standard Daily Cost Subscription Daily Cost Supply Duration
30 Count $34.95 $29.71 $2.33 $1.98 15 Days
90 Count $79.95 $67.96 $1.78 $1.51 45 Days

Quality Control and Transparency Standards

A critical area of analysis for Alpha Brain is its approach to testing and transparency. Unlike some competitors, such as Mind Lab Pro, Onnit does not post Certificates of Analysis (CoAs) for public viewing. CoAs are essential documents that delineate the results of testing for individual ingredients and product batches.

Onnit conducts all of its testing in-house at its own facility. While the company performs these tests, the refusal to share the results publicly leads to a lack of transparency. Furthermore, the product is not third-party tested, which is a common standard for high-quality supplements.

The regulatory environment for Alpha Brain is also distinct. As a supplement, it is not held to the same stringent FDA requirements as prescription medications or food products. This means the burden of proof for safety and efficacy rests more heavily on the company's internal research rather than government-mandated clinical trials.

The current state of evidence for Alpha Brain includes self-funded studies. While these studies provide some insight, the risk of bias in self-funded research is a point of concern. Expert analysis suggests that independent third-party studies would be necessary to fully validate the claims made regarding cognitive enhancement.

Conclusion

The analysis of Onnit Alpha Brain reveals a product that excels in consumer accessibility and branding but falls short in scientific transparency. The product's strength lies in its caffeine-free formulation and its commitment to a user-friendly experience, from the rubberized grip of the bottle lid to the clear, readable labeling. The financial incentives, particularly the "Keep-It" money-back guarantee and the 25% subscription discount, lower the barrier to entry for new users seeking cognitive support.

However, the architectural choice to use proprietary blends is a significant point of contention. By obscuring exact dosages, Onnit limits the ability of users and healthcare providers to fully assess the risk of side effects or the likelihood of efficacy. This is compounded by the absence of third-party testing and the reliance on in-house Certificates of Analysis that are not shared with the public.

While anecdotal reports and self-funded studies suggest a positive impact on verbal memory and focus, the lack of independent verification means that Alpha Brain's claims cannot be fully validated. For the cautious consumer, this creates a trade-off between a polished, professional user experience and a desire for rigorous, transparent scientific data. Ultimately, Alpha Brain is a reasonably priced nootropic that provides a convenient, stimulant-free option for cognitive support, provided the user is comfortable with the company's internal-only testing model.
